Comeback Kid have re-recorded the title track of their 2005 album “Wake The Dead.” A music video for the 20th anniversary edition of the song can be found below:
Vocalist Andrew Neufeld commented:
“The title track of our album ‘Wake The Dead,’ which that we released two decades ago, provided us with more opportunities and brought us to more places around the world than we could have ever imagined. The song lands as the biggest moment in every single set that we’ve played — from Asia through South America to Europe, Africa, and North America.
We wrote and recorded the song while I was still playing guitar in the band. After 19 years of being the vocalist, and singing the song every night, we would like to celebrate and commemorate a song that gave us wings that we never knew existed by re-recording it with our current lineup and with a fresh mix provided by Will Putney.
We will be releasing the single alongside an unreleased B-side from the original 2005 Wake The Dead recording sessions on 7″, along with a number of variations of the full length re-pressed with new packaging!”
